.contact-hero[data-astro-cid-4irszvcr]{padding:var(--gl-space-7) 0 var(--gl-space-5);background:var(--gl-background)}.contact-eyebrow[data-astro-cid-4irszvcr]{font-family:var(--gl-font-mono);font-size:.875rem;letter-spacing:.16em;text-transform:uppercase;color:var(--gl-link);margin:0 0 var(--gl-space-2) 0;font-weight:600}.contact-title[data-astro-cid-4irszvcr]{font-size:clamp(2.5rem,5vw,3.75rem);line-height:1.1;font-weight:300;letter-spacing:-.02em;margin:0 0 var(--gl-space-3) 0;max-width:20ch}.contact-desc[data-astro-cid-4irszvcr]{font-size:1.25rem;line-height:1.6;color:var(--gl-text-secondary);margin:0;max-width:52ch}.gl-bandAlt[data-astro-cid-4irszvcr]{background:var(--gl-layer-01);padding:var(--gl-space-5) 0}.support-grid[data-astro-cid-4irszvcr]{display:grid;grid-template-columns:repeat(3,1fr);gap:var(--gl-space-3)}.support-card[data-astro-cid-4irszvcr]{background:var(--gl-layer-02);border:1px solid var(--gl-border-subtle);padding:var(--gl-space-4)}.support-icon[data-astro-cid-4irszvcr]{width:48px;height:48px;display:flex;align-items:center;justify-content:center;background:var(--gl-background);border:1px solid var(--gl-border-subtle);margin-bottom:var(--gl-space-3)}.support-icon[data-astro-cid-4irszvcr] svg[data-astro-cid-4irszvcr]{width:24px;height:24px;color:var(--gl-text-secondary)}.support-title[data-astro-cid-4irszvcr]{font-size:1.05rem;font-weight:600;margin:0 0 var(--gl-space-1) 0}.support-desc[data-astro-cid-4irszvcr]{font-size:.9rem;color:var(--gl-text-secondary);margin:0 0 var(--gl-space-2) 0;line-height:1.5}.support-link[data-astro-cid-4irszvcr]{font-size:.9rem;color:var(--gl-link);text-decoration:none;font-weight:500}.support-link[data-astro-cid-4irszvcr]:hover{text-decoration:underline}.form-section[data-astro-cid-4irszvcr]{max-width:48rem;margin:0 auto}.form-header[data-astro-cid-4irszvcr]{text-align:center;margin-bottom:var(--gl-space-5)}.form-header[data-astro-cid-4irszvcr] .gl-h2[data-astro-cid-4irszvcr]{margin-bottom:var(--gl-space-2)}.form-subtitle[data-astro-cid-4irszvcr]{color:var(--gl-text-secondary);margin:0}.contact-form[data-astro-cid-4irszvcr]{background:var(--gl-layer-01);border:1px solid var(--gl-border-subtle);padding:var(--gl-space-5)}.form-row[data-astro-cid-4irszvcr]{display:grid;grid-template-columns:1fr 1fr;gap:var(--gl-space-3)}.form-field[data-astro-cid-4irszvcr]{margin-bottom:var(--gl-space-3)}.form-label[data-astro-cid-4irszvcr]{display:block;font-size:.875rem;font-weight:500;margin-bottom:var(--gl-space-1);color:var(--gl-text-primary)}.form-optional[data-astro-cid-4irszvcr]{font-weight:400;color:var(--gl-text-secondary)}.form-input[data-astro-cid-4irszvcr],.form-textarea[data-astro-cid-4irszvcr]{width:100%;padding:.75rem 1rem;font-size:1rem;font-family:var(--gl-font-sans);background:var(--gl-background);color:var(--gl-text-primary);border:1px solid var(--gl-border-subtle);transition:border-color .15s ease,box-shadow .15s ease}.form-input[data-astro-cid-4irszvcr]:focus,.form-textarea[data-astro-cid-4irszvcr]:focus{outline:none;border-color:var(--gl-link);box-shadow:0 0 0 2px #0f62fe33}.form-input[data-astro-cid-4irszvcr]::placeholder,.form-textarea[data-astro-cid-4irszvcr]::placeholder{color:var(--gl-text-secondary)}.form-textarea[data-astro-cid-4irszvcr]{resize:vertical;min-height:150px}.form-footer[data-astro-cid-4irszvcr]{display:flex;align-items:center;justify-content:space-between;gap:var(--gl-space-4);margin-top:var(--gl-space-4)}.form-privacy[data-astro-cid-4irszvcr]{font-size:.8rem;color:var(--gl-text-secondary);max-width:28ch;line-height:1.5}.form-privacy[data-astro-cid-4irszvcr] a[data-astro-cid-4irszvcr]{color:var(--gl-link);text-decoration:underline}.form-submit[data-astro-cid-4irszvcr]{white-space:nowrap}.form-success[data-astro-cid-4irszvcr],.form-error[data-astro-cid-4irszvcr]{display:none;margin-top:var(--gl-space-4)}.form-successInner[data-astro-cid-4irszvcr],.form-errorInner[data-astro-cid-4irszvcr]{display:flex;flex-direction:column;align-items:center;text-align:center;padding:var(--gl-space-5);background:var(--gl-background);border:1px solid}.form-successInner[data-astro-cid-4irszvcr]{border-color:#198038;color:#198038}.form-errorInner[data-astro-cid-4irszvcr]{border-color:#da1e28;color:#da1e28}.form-successInner[data-astro-cid-4irszvcr] svg[data-astro-cid-4irszvcr],.form-errorInner[data-astro-cid-4irszvcr] svg[data-astro-cid-4irszvcr]{width:48px;height:48px;margin-bottom:var(--gl-space-2)}.form-successInner[data-astro-cid-4irszvcr] p[data-astro-cid-4irszvcr],.form-errorInner[data-astro-cid-4irszvcr] p[data-astro-cid-4irszvcr]{margin:0}.form-successInner[data-astro-cid-4irszvcr] p[data-astro-cid-4irszvcr]:last-child,.form-errorInner[data-astro-cid-4irszvcr] p[data-astro-cid-4irszvcr]:last-child{margin-top:var(--gl-space-1);color:var(--gl-text-secondary)}.form-errorInner[data-astro-cid-4irszvcr] a[data-astro-cid-4irszvcr]{color:var(--gl-link);text-decoration:underline}[data-astro-cid-4irszvcr][data-fs-success]~.form-success[data-astro-cid-4irszvcr],[data-astro-cid-4irszvcr][data-fs-success]+.form-success[data-astro-cid-4irszvcr]{display:block}[data-astro-cid-4irszvcr][data-fs-error]~.form-error[data-astro-cid-4irszvcr],[data-astro-cid-4irszvcr][data-fs-error]+.form-error[data-astro-cid-4irszvcr]{display:block}[data-astro-cid-4irszvcr][data-fs-success] .form-submit[data-astro-cid-4irszvcr],[data-astro-cid-4irszvcr][data-fs-error] .form-submit[data-astro-cid-4irszvcr]{display:none}@media(max-width:64rem){.support-grid[data-astro-cid-4irszvcr]{grid-template-columns:1fr;gap:var(--gl-space-2)}.form-row[data-astro-cid-4irszvcr]{grid-template-columns:1fr}.form-footer[data-astro-cid-4irszvcr]{flex-direction:column;align-items:stretch}.form-privacy[data-astro-cid-4irszvcr]{max-width:none;text-align:center}.form-submit[data-astro-cid-4irszvcr]{width:100%}}@media(max-width:48rem){.contact-hero[data-astro-cid-4irszvcr]{padding:var(--gl-space-5) 0 var(--gl-space-4)}.contact-title[data-astro-cid-4irszvcr]{font-size:2rem}.contact-desc[data-astro-cid-4irszvcr]{font-size:1.1rem}.contact-form[data-astro-cid-4irszvcr]{padding:var(--gl-space-4)}}
